PCTFE seals, also known as polychlorotrifluoroethylene seals, are a type of polymer seal that offers exceptional chemical resistance, thermal stability, and low permeability They are commonly used in a variety of industries, including aerospace, pharmaceutical, and semiconductor manufacturing In this article, we will dive deep into the world of PCTFE seals, exploring their properties, applications, benefits, and more.

Properties of PCTFE Seals:
PCTFE seals are known for their excellent chemical resistance, making them suitable for use in harsh chemical environments where other materials may fail They are resistant to a wide range of chemicals, including acids, bases, and solvents, making them ideal for use in critical applications where chemical exposure is a concern Additionally, PCTFE seals have high thermal stability, with a continuous use temperature range of -240°C to 150°C, making them suitable for use in both cryogenic and high-temperature applications

Applications of PCTFE Seals:
PCTFE seals are used in a wide range of applications across various industries In the aerospace industry, PCTFE seals are commonly used in fuel systems, hydraulic systems, and other critical applications where chemical resistance and thermal stability are essential In the pharmaceutical industry, PCTFE seals are used in drug delivery systems, laboratory equipment, and other applications where purity and chemical resistance are critical In the semiconductor industry, PCTFE seals are used in gas delivery systems, vacuum systems, and other high-purity applications where contamination must be minimized.

Benefits of PCTFE Seals:
There are several key benefits to using PCTFE seals in industrial applications One of the main benefits is their exceptional chemical resistance, which allows them to withstand exposure to a wide range of harsh chemicals without degrading or failing pctfe seal. This makes them ideal for use in environments where chemical exposure is a concern, such as in the aerospace and pharmaceutical industries Additionally, PCTFE seals offer low permeability, meaning they are able to maintain a reliable seal over extended periods without leaking or losing pressure This makes them ideal for use in applications where leakage cannot be tolerated
